Output 8c61f41d6fd6b538f062aa142eea6ac9438821ecdff5981768ee395254e7db4e:0

value
61500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b0080613d47849511ce5a700553a4a7f99e318d OP_EQUAL
address
MHew8oLbWxBMY73bLTw3Dg4UA5EN4uEJd1
transaction
8c61f41d6fd6b538f062aa142eea6ac9438821ecdff5981768ee395254e7db4e
spent
true